1.True or false? Gametogenesis is the same as meiosis?
Lostsunrise [7]

1. False. They are similar, though.

meiosis- A kind of cell division involving having the chromosome number. It is responsible for genetic recombination.

Gametogenesis- It's the process when gametes or germ cells are produced in an organism. They undergo meiosis to form gametes.

2. Spermatogenesis- happens in the testes of males. 4 gametes are produced. Spermatogenesis involves a metamorphosis stage called spermiogenesis. Spermatogenesis produces small, motile spermatozoa

Oogenesis- takes place in the ovary in a female. 1 gamete produced. in oogenesis there is no metamorphosis stage. In oogenesis the ovum is spherical, and isn't motile and is bigger with more food reserves and cytoplasm.

3. Because The one egg cell that results from meiosis contains most of the cytoplasm, nutrients, and organelles.

The length and complexity of a food web in the Arctic would be ____ when compared to one in the tropical rainforest.
Vlad [161]

Answer:

The correct answer is - option A. short and less complex.

Explanation:

A food web is a network of many food chains. The food chain is one pathway that describes the path of the animals finds food, it is linear representation. Food web shows all the plants and animals in connection with each other in the food web.

In the Arctic, biodiversity is comparatively low with fewer species of flora and very less number of fauna that include caribou, hare, musk ox pika, and insects are the primary consumers.

Secondary consumer eats herbivores and these organisms are normally are top trophic levels in arctic include fish and polar bear. So the consumers, primary consumer and predators or secondary consumers form a short and less complex.

Thus, the correct answer is - option A. short and less complex.

Arteries carry blood away from the heart.<br><br> True<br><br> False
shutvik [7]

Answer:

True

Explanation:

The arteries (red) carry oxygen and nutrients away from your heart, to your body's tissues. The veins (blue) take oxygen-poor blood back to the heart. Arteries begin with the aorta, the large artery leaving the heart. They carry oxygen-rich blood away from the heart to all of the body's tissues.
